Ohio State vs. Marshall game today: channel, time, streaming information

After a week off, Ohio State's football team has one last warm-up before it really gets into Big Ten play.

Ryan Day, Will Howard and the Buckeyes will face the Marshall Thundering Herd in a Big Noon showdown while Ohio State looks to improve its season record to 3-0 following its off week.

The Buckeyes have performed as advertised in their first two games, outscoring Akron and Western Michigan by a combined score of 108-6. The third-best team in the country will look to continue that dominant success ahead of a game against Michigan State in East Lansing next week.

Marshall dominated Stony Brook in similar fashion in Week 1 before losing to Virginia Tech in Week 2, and is also coming off a break from playing. Stone Earle struggled mightily against the Hokies, completing 13 of 36 passes for 131 yards, a touchdown and an interception. Ohio State's vaunted secondary, led by Caleb Downs, will look to create similar confusion. That will start by hampering the running game, which Ohio State has done second best in the country, only better than Ole Miss.
